Nickel 689 vs. AWS ERTi-1

Nickel 689 belongs to the nickel alloys classification, while AWS ERTi-1 belongs to the titanium alloys. There are 25 material properties with values for both materials. Properties with values for just one material (7, in this case) are not shown.

For each property being compared, the top bar is nickel 689 and the bottom bar is AWS ERTi-1.
